Estepona — FAQ
How to spend a day in Estepona?
Start your day with a stroll along the Paseo Marítimo, enjoy lunch at a beachfront restaurant, and explore the charming Old Town. Don't miss the local market for unique finds.
Is Estepona Old Town worth visiting?
Absolutely! Estepona's Old Town is known for its picturesque streets, vibrant flower pots, and historical sites, making it a must-visit for anyone in the area.
What day is market day in Estepona?
The weekly market in Estepona takes place on Wednesdays, offering a variety of local produce, crafts, and goods. It's a great way to experience local culture.
Is there a lot to do in Estepona?
Yes, Estepona offers a wide range of activities including beach days, golf, hiking in the nearby Sierra Bermeja, and exploring local shops and restaurants.
What is the nicest beach in Estepona?
Playa de la Rada is often considered the nicest beach in Estepona, featuring golden sands, clear waters, and plenty of amenities for visitors.
Where can I swim in Estepona?
You can swim at various beaches in Estepona including Playa del Cristo and Sunset Beach, both known for their calm waters and family-friendly environments.
What are some must-see things in Estepona?
Must-see attractions include the Jardín de la Costa del Sol, the historic Old Town, and the local markets. Don't forget to visit the beautiful beaches!
Which is nicer, Nerja or Estepona?
Both towns have their unique charm. Estepona offers a more traditional Andalusian experience, while Nerja is known for its stunning cliffs and caves. Your choice depends on your preferences.
